Presented in [1] were characteristics and operation technology of backward channel set up for broadband Internet access. This paper considers set up of territorial corporate computer network for geographically-distributed objects monitoring. We consider creation of computer network intended for wind power stations monitoring. Such stations are located basically in the Crimea and in the south of Zaporozhye and Kherson regions.
